摘要

The efficient isolation of bacterial DNA from different sample materials is crucial for fast and sensitive detection of microorganisms by polymerase chain reaction (PCR). Automation of such procedures is of tremendous help in the microbiology lab [1-5]. We therefore developed the new MagNA Pure LC DNA Isolation Kit III (Bacteria, Fungi) for the automated isolation of bacterial and fungal DNA from various types of research sample materials on the MagNA Pure LC Instrument. The standard protocol consists of very few manual steps (i.e., addition of a lysis buffer/proteinase cocktail and a heating step). All subsequent DNA isolation steps are automated on the MagNA Pure LC. The kit was tested with a variety of difficult sample materials like bronchoalveolar lavage (BAL), urine, sputum, stool, swabs, cerebrospinal fluid (SCF), tracheal secretion, blood and bacterial cultures. Samples were spiked with a known amount of certain Gram-positive and Gram-negative bacteria of with fungi, and the DNA was isolated and analyzed by species-specific PCR assays in the LightCycler (LC) Instrument [1-3].
机译:从不同样品材料中有效分离细菌DNA对于通过聚合酶链反应(PCR)快速,灵敏地检测微生物至关重要。这样的程序的自动化在微生物实验室[1-5]中有巨大的帮助。因此,我们开发了新的MagNA Pure LC DNA分离试剂盒III(细菌,真菌),用于在MagNA Pure LC仪器上从各种类型的研究样品材料中自动分离细菌和真菌DNA。标准方案由很少的手动步骤组成(即添加裂解液/蛋白酶混合物和加热步骤)。所有后续的DNA分离步骤均在MagNA Pure LC上自动进行。该试剂盒用各种困难的样品材料进行了测试,例如支气管肺泡灌洗(BAL),尿液,痰,粪便,药签,脑脊液(SCF),气管分泌物,血液和细菌培养物。样品中掺入已知量的某些带有真菌的革兰氏阳性和革兰氏阴性细菌,然后在LightCycler(LC)仪器中通过种特异性PCR测定法分离并分析DNA [1-3]。
